Beyond process management, security in transportation and operation is verified through UN-38.3 certification. This essential requirement involves exposing batteries to severe tests, including altitude simulation, temperature changes, shaking, shock, and outside short circuit tests. Solely products that pass these rigorous evaluations are deemed safe for international transport and installation. Compliance with these rules is mandatory for any company that plans to distribute products across borders or use flight freight, as it confirms that the power source device is steady under stress situations.
